1、请求从缓存中获取数据,若数据为空(数据过期或不存在),则访问数据库获取数据,同时将数据存入Redis中; 2、请求从缓存中获取数据,若数据存在,则直接从缓存获取该数据。 一、存储方式 缓存中的数据...
12-04 661
react路由跳转导致重新渲染 |
react路由缓存,前端缓存
可以结合一下redux-persist使用嘛。不仅可以对Redux 的Store 中需要存储的值进行缓存,还可以指定各种搭配react-router工作的、带缓存功能的路由组件,类似于Vue中的keep-alive功能React v15+ React-Router v4+ 遇到的问题使用Route时,路由对应的组件在前进或后
●ω● 具体来说,React-Router-Cache-Route的实现原理如下:1. 创建一个缓存对象在React-Router-Cache-Route组件被渲染时,会创建一个缓存对象。这个缓存对象用来存储已经加载的路此插件可以满足缓存上一页的功能,即:返回上一页的时候,上一页的滚动条、动作状态等等和离开这个页面时的状态保持一致。简介搭配react-router 工作的、带缓存
新建路由组件(其实就时页面的壳子) import Reactfrom'react';// 缓存组件,步骤一定义的import ComponentCachefrom'@/component/cache';// 页面里要显示的内容import CachefroReact Keepalive 是一个用于监听组件状态变化的库,它可以在组件状态发生变化时自动更新页面内容。在React Router 中,我们可以使用React Keepalive 来缓存路由,从而实现页面
≥ω≤ react-antd-admin 是一个后台集成解决方案,它基于react 和antd; 内置了动态路由,标签页缓存,权限验证、切换功能- Lirong6/react-antd-adminreact 路由缓存有需求需要切换路由后回到之前的页面保持之前的搜索条件,内容等,所有要用到路由缓存,由于react的机制问题无法实现这中需求,所以找到下面这些辅
1.首先实现一下通过react-keepalive-router进行路由缓存优化实现原理:初始化:选择该页面,读取页面内容切换页面:将当前页面存入缓存,查看当前页面是否在缓存五、使用react-activation实现路由缓存安装包:react-activation npminstall react-activation 在入口处使用
后台-插件-广告管理-内容页尾部广告(手机) |
标签: 前端缓存
相关文章
1、请求从缓存中获取数据,若数据为空(数据过期或不存在),则访问数据库获取数据,同时将数据存入Redis中; 2、请求从缓存中获取数据,若数据存在,则直接从缓存获取该数据。 一、存储方式 缓存中的数据...
12-04 661
态度是一种直观的心理状态。态度和价值观念的不一致,使交往双方对彼此的思想、情感和行为方式有不同的理解,从而影响大学生人际交往关系。 (6)个性品质或人格...
12-04 661
经事后网上查询,有和我相同遭遇的不少案例,这种注胶根本就没效果,事后我也多次打电话要求那位沈师傅提供进货凭证,证明其用的是进口胶水,和雨虹公司的质保承诺,但因为他们实际上都是...
12-04 661
发表评论
评论列表